Transaction 5329cb31e1a2081ac3ff52f4f5d2a7699a0352de64c3d135784d9952cf24d621

1 Input
2 Outputs
  • 5329cb31e1a2081ac3ff52f4f5d2a7699a0352de64c3d135784d9952cf24d621:0
  • value  18098416
    address  1MKSeAizuVortzizWHqeDxCKFnvBzLJcMF
  • 5329cb31e1a2081ac3ff52f4f5d2a7699a0352de64c3d135784d9952cf24d621:1
  • value  20384058
    address  3C3WUyNALdgae1NdrAePt9BU8FsU5p34Ey